MORTGAGE, ASSIGNMENT OF LEASES AND RENTS, SECURITY AGREEMENT,
FINANCING STATEMENT AND FIXTURE FILING

 

This Mortgage, Assignment of Leases and Rents, Security Agreement, Financing Statement and Fixture Filing (as amended, amended and restated, supplemented, renewed, or otherwise modified from time to time, this “Mortgage”), is made as of the 22nd day of May, 2026 (“Effective Date”), by 256 COUNTY ROUTE 117 PERTH LLC, a Delaware limited liability company, having an address at c/o Vireo Growth Inc., 207 South 9th Street, Minneapolis, Minnesota 55402 (“Mortgagor”) to CHICAGO ATLANTIC FINANCIAL SERVICES, LLC, a Delaware limited liability company, as Administrative Agent, having an address at 420 N Wabash Avenue, Suite 500, Chicago, Illinois 60611 (in such capacity, together with its successors and assigns in such capacity, “Mortgagee”).

 

Recitals

 

A.            This Mortgage is given by Mortgagor to Mortgagee to secure that certain loan to be made on May 26, 2026, in the original principal amount of FORTY-ONE MILLION AND NO/100 DOLLARS ($41,000,000.00) (the “Loan”).

 

B.            The Loan is evidenced by, among other things, that certain Promissory Note, dated the Effective Date, given by Mortgagor, as borrower, in favor of Chicago Atlantic Lincoln, LLC, as lender (such promissory note, together with any and all extensions, renewals, replacements, restatements, modifications, or consolidations thereof, whether, in each case, one or more, collectively, the “Notes” and each, a “Note”; all capitalized terms used herein but not defined herein shall have the meanings given such terms in the Note).

 

C.            The Loan is further secured by that certain Guaranty, dated as of the Effective Date, given by Vireo Health, Inc., a Delaware corporation (“Guarantor”) in favor of Mortgagee, for the benefit of Secured Creditors (the “Guaranty”).

 

D.            Mortgagee has been indemnified from environmental losses as more fully set out in that certain Environmental and Hazardous Substances Indemnity Agreement dated as of the Effective Date, given jointly by Guarantor, as principal, and Mortgagor, as borrower (the “Environmental Indemnity”).

 

E.            Each Note, this Mortgage, the Guaranty, the Environmental Indemnity, and all other documents and instruments delivered in connection with the Loan, as each may be amended, restated, supplemented, or otherwise modified from time to time in accordance with the terms hereof, are collectively referred to herein as the “Loan Documents.”

 

F.            Mortgagor hereby desires to secure the payment of all principal and interest payments that accrue or are due and payable from time to time in accordance with the Notes, together with all other amounts due in accordance with the other Loan Documents (collectively, hereafter the “Debt”) and to further secure the performance and observance of all obligations of Mortgagor under this Mortgage and the other Loan Documents.

 

1


 

 

G.            The Debt and all covenants, obligations, payments, and liabilities of every kind and nature owed by Mortgagor to Mortgagee or the other Secured Creditors, whether direct or indirect, absolute or contingent, due or to become due, now existing or hereinafter incurred, arising under, out of, or in connection with the Loan and the Loan Documents are hereafter, collectively referred to herein as “Obligations.

 

NOW, THEREFORE, in consideration of the premises and other good and valuable consideration, the receipt and sufficiency of which are hereby acknowledged, and to secure the due and punctual payment and performance of all Obligations as and when the same become due and payable, Mortgagor hereby represents, warrants, covenants, and agrees for the benefit of Mortgagee, for the benefit of Secured Creditors, as follows:

 

ARTICLE I 

GRANT OF SECURITY INTERESTS AND 

OBLIGATIONS SECURED

 

Section 1.01 Grant to Mortgagee. In order to secure the due and punctual payment and performance of all the Obligations as and when the same shall become due, whether at the stated maturity, by acceleration, or otherwise, Mortgagor does hereby MORTGAGE, PLEDGE, BARGAIN, ASSIGN, TRANSFER, WARRANT, CONVEY, AND GRANT, to Mortgagee, for the benefit of Secured Creditors, the following property, rights, interests, and estates, now owned or hereafter acquired by Mortgagor (collectively, “Property”):

 

(a)            Land. All that certain tract or parcel of land lying and being in Fulton County, New York and being more particularly described in Exhibit A attached hereto and incorporated herein by reference, together with all utilities, rights, interests, and estates of every kind and nature therein, including and to the full extent owned by Mortgagor, development rights, air rights, water, water rights, and rights to minerals and other natural resources that can be extracted therefrom (collectively, “Land”).

 

(b)            Improvements. All buildings, structures, and improvements of every kind and nature whatsoever now or hereafter situated on the Land (collectively, “Improvements”).

 

(c)            Easements and Appurtenances. All easements, rights-of-way or use, strips and gores of land, streets, alleyways, passages, utility reservations, capacity rights, water courses, privileges, liberties, tenements, hereditaments, and appurtenances of any kind or nature belonging, relating, or appertaining to the Land or the Improvements, or any part thereof, including any reversionary or remainder estates together with the income and profits therefrom (collectively, “Easements and Appurtenances”).

 

(d)            Fixtures. All goods of every kind and nature that become attached to, affixed to, or installed on the Land or Improvements thereby creating rights and interests arising under the New York real property law, including any item defined as fixtures under the Uniform Commercial Code as adopted by New York State (the “NY UCC”) together with all replacements and substitutions thereof (collectively, “Fixtures”).

 

2


 

 

 

(e)            Personal Property. All equipment, building systems, machinery, materials, supplies, and items of personal property of every kind and nature (other than Fixtures) now or hereafter located on or used in connection with the operation of the Land or Improvements, together with all replacements and substitutions thereof (collectively, “Personal Property”).

 

(f)            Leases and Rents. All Mortgagor’s right, title, and interest in all leases, subleases, licenses and other agreements granting another (each, a “Tenant”) the right to use or occupy any part of the Property (each, a “Lease”) including that certain agreement captioned “Lease Agreement” (collectively, and as may have been and may be amended from time to time, the “Vireo NY Lease”) dated as of October 23, 2017, by and between Mortgagor, as landlord and Vireo Health of New York, LLC, a New York limited liability company (“Vireo NY Tenant”), including the right to receive and apply Rents (as hereinafter defined). The term “Rents” shall mean, collectively:

 

(i)            All rents, additional rents, income, revenues, profits, cash proceeds, and other monetary benefits now due or hereafter becoming due under any Lease;

 

(ii)            All guaranties, letters of credit, promissory notes, security deposits, and other credit support given by any Tenant or guarantor, including the Vireo NY Tenant in connection with the Vireo NY Lease;

 

(iii)          All claims and rights to the payment of damages arising from the rejection of any Lease under the Bankruptcy Reform Act of 1978, codified as 11 U.S.C. § 101 et seq., and the regulations issued thereunder, both as hereafter modified from time to time (the “Bankruptcy Code”); and

 

(iv)          All rights to casualty and condemnation proceeds assigned to Mortgagor under any Lease.

 

(g)            Property Tax Refunds. All refunds, rebates, and credits in connection with any reduction in Taxes (as hereinafter defined), including rebates as a result of tax certiorari or other such proceedings, except to the extent owed to a Tenant under a Lease. As used in the Loan Documents, “Taxes” means all real estate taxes, government assessments or impositions, lienable water charges, lienable sewer rents, assessments due under owner association documents, and all similar charges, now or hereafter levied or assessed against the Land and Improvements.

 

(h)            Proceeds of Property Sale. All proceeds and profits arising from the sale or conversion (voluntary or involuntary) of any Property into cash (whether made in one payment or in a stream of payments) and any liquidation claims applicable thereto.

 

(i)             Intangibles. All chattel paper, claims, trade names, trademarks, service marks, logos, copyrights, goodwill, books and records, and all other general intangibles related to or used in connection with the ownership or operation of the Property.

 

(j)             Property Agreements. All agreements, service contracts, supply contracts, permits, franchises, and licenses (including and to the extent assignable, liquor licenses), if any, pertaining to the ownership or operation of the Property, together with all amendments, restatements, supplements, renewals, extensions, and substitutions thereof and all Mortgagor’s rights, if any, to sums due Mortgagor thereunder (collectively, “Property Agreements”).

 

3


 

 

 

(k)            Omnibus Rights. Any and all other rights of Mortgagor in and to the Property, including any other rights associated with any Property described in the foregoing subsections (a) through (j) inclusive.

 

TO HAVE AND TO HOLD the Property and the rights, remedies, and privileges hereby granted and conveyed unto Mortgagee, for the benefit of Secured Creditors, forever, PROVIDED, HOWEVER, if Mortgagor shall pay the Debt and perform all other Obligations in the time and manner provided in the Loan Documents, then the conveyance and granting made herein shall cease and be of no further force and effect.

 

Section 1.02 Obligations Secured; Incorporation by Reference. This Mortgage is given to secure the due and punctual payment and performance of all Obligations set forth in the Notes and other Loan Documents as and when the same shall become due, whether at the stated due date, at maturity, by acceleration, or otherwise. All the covenants, conditions, and agreements contained in the Notes and other Loan Documents are hereby made a part of this Mortgage to the same extent and with the same force as if fully set forth herein. In the event of a conflict between the terms of this Mortgage and any other Loan Document, the terms of this Mortgage shall govern.

 

Section 1.03 Mortgage as Security Agreement and Financing Statement.

 

(a)            Designation as Security Agreement. This Mortgage shall constitute a security agreement and financing statement within the meaning of the NY UCC with respect to all Mortgagor’s present and future estate, right, title, and interest in and to such Property conveyed to Mortgagee, for the benefit of Secured Creditors, pursuant to Section 1.01 that is not real property.

 

(b)            Election of Remedies. With respect to Fixtures and Personal Property, upon the occurrence and during the continuance of an Event of Default (as hereinafter defined), Mortgagee shall have the right to proceed against the Fixtures and Personal Property either: (i) in accordance with Mortgagee’s rights and remedies under this Mortgage, in which event the provisions of the NY UCC shall not govern; or (ii) separately from the Land in accordance with the NY UCC.

 

(c)            Separate Security Agreements. If Mortgagor has executed and delivered one or more separate security agreements in connection with the Loan, such security agreements and the security interests created thereby are in addition to and not in substitution of this Mortgage and the Liens and security interests created hereby, and this Mortgage shall be in addition to and not in substitution of such security agreements and security interests. In all cases, this Mortgage and the aforesaid security agreements shall be applied and enforced in harmony with and in conjunction with each other to the end that Mortgagee realizes its rights, interests, and remedies in each to the greatest extent permitted by law. If conflicts exist among this Mortgage and such other security agreements, Mortgagee may elect which of such instruments govern with respect to each category of Property encumbered by such instruments and agreements.

 

4


 

 

 

Section 1.04 Mortgage as Fixture Filing. The filing or recording of this Mortgage shall constitute a fixture filing with respect to that portion of the Property which is or will become Fixtures and Personal Property to the fullest extent permitted under New York law. The “Secured Party” is Mortgagee, and the “Debtor” is Mortgagor. The name, type of organization, jurisdiction of organization, and addresses of the Secured Party and of the Debtor are set out in the preamble to this Mortgage.

 

ARTICLE II 

ASSIGNMENT OF LEASES AND RENTS

 

Section 2.01 Assignment of Leases and Rents.

 

(a)            Absolute Assignment of Leases and Rents. In furtherance of the grant, pledge, and conveyance of the Leases and Rents pursuant to Section 1.01(f), Mortgagor hereby absolutely, presently, irrevocably, and unconditionally grants, assigns, and transfers to Mortgagee, for the benefit of Secured Creditors, to the extent permitted by Applicable Law (as hereinafter defined), all Mortgagor’s present and future right, title, interest, and estate in, to, and under all current and future Leases and Rents, and the absolute, present, irrevocable, and unconditional right to receive, collect, and possess all Rents. This assignment constitutes an absolute, present, irrevocable, and unconditional assignment of Leases and Rents, not merely a collateral assignment to further secure the lien of this Mortgage.

 

(b)            Mortgagee Exculpation. Notwithstanding the present, absolute nature of the assignment made under this Article II, such assignment shall not be construed to:

 

(i)             Bind Mortgagee to the performance of any of the covenants, conditions, or provisions contained in any Lease or otherwise impose any obligation upon Mortgagee.

 

(ii)            Create or impose any responsibility, obligation, or liability upon Mortgagee of any kind or nature, including for:

 

(A)            the control, care, maintenance, management, or repair of the Property;

 

(B)            any dangerous or defective condition of the Property, including the presence of any environmental contamination or hazardous condition;

 

(C)            any waste committed on the Property by any Person; or

 

(D)            any negligence in the management, upkeep, repair, or control of the Property.

 

5


 

 

 

Section 2.02 Revocable License.

 

(a)            Grant of Revocable License. Notwithstanding the present grant, assignment, and transfer of the Leases and Rents from Mortgagor to Mortgagee made in Section 2.01, Mortgagee hereby grants to Mortgagor a revocable license to collect and receive Rents as they become due, and to retain, use, and apply Rents to the payment of the Obligations and to the costs and expenses of operating and maintaining the Property, and to exercise all rights as landlord under any Lease, in each case subject to the terms of this Mortgage and the other Loan Documents.

 

(b)            Revocation of License. Upon the occurrence and during the continuance of an Event of Default, the revocable license granted to Mortgagor pursuant to Section 2.02(a)  shall immediately cease without the necessity of notice from Mortgagee and become void and of no further force or effect. Notwithstanding the foregoing, if such Event of Default has been cured and such cure has been accepted in writing by Mortgagee, such revocable license shall be automatically reinstated. Mortgagee’s right under this Section 2.02(b) to revoke the revocable license granted hereby is in addition to all other rights and remedies available to Mortgagee at law and in equity. From and after revocation:

 

(i)             Mortgagee shall immediately and automatically be entitled to receive, collect, and possess all Rents, whether or not Mortgagee enters upon or takes control of the Property, has a receiver appointed, or takes any other action permitted by the Loan Documents, at law, or in equity;

 

(ii)            Mortgagor shall immediately, upon written demand by Mortgagee, notify the applicable Tenant under the applicable Lease (or any subsequent tenant under any Lease), in writing, that all Rents due from and after the date of such notice shall be paid to Mortgagee at the address set forth in such notice;

 

(iii)          All Rents then or thereafter received by Mortgagor shall be immediately delivered to Mortgagee without the necessity of written demand, and until delivered, shall be held in trust for the benefit of Mortgagee; and

 

(iv)          All Rents received by Mortgagee pursuant to this Section 2.02(b) may, at Mortgagee’s option, be applied to the Debt or in payment of any other Obligation set forth in the Loan Documents, in such order or priority as Mortgagee shall determine in its discretion.

 

Section 2.03 Mortgagee’s Rights After License Revocation. From and after any revocation of the license granted pursuant to Section 2.02(a), Mortgagee shall have the right, but not the obligation, at its option and in addition to its other rights and remedies available to Mortgagee under law, acting personally or through an agent, and without the necessity of taking possession of the Property or bringing any enforcement action or proceeding, including foreclosure, or the appointment of a receiver, to take any or all the following actions to the fullest extent permitted by law:

 

(a)            Direct Payments of Rent. Notify each Tenant that the Lease to which it is a party has been assigned to Mortgagee and that all Rents are to be paid at the direction of Mortgagee. The term “Person” means an individual, partnership, limited partnership, corporation, limited liability company, business trust, joint stock company, trust, unincorporated association, joint venture, governmental authority, or any other entity of whatever nature.

 

6


 

 

 

(b)            Modify Lease Obligations. Settle, compromise, release, extend the time of payment for, and make allowances, adjustments, and discounts of any Rents or other obligations in, to, and under any Lease.

 

(c)             Rent the Property and Modify any Lease. Lease all or any part of the Property and/or modify, amend, renew, or terminate any Lease.

 

(d)            Perform Lease Obligations. Perform any and all obligations of Mortgagor under any Lease and exercise any and all rights of Mortgagor therein contained to the full extent of Mortgagor’s rights and obligations thereunder.

 

ARTICLE III

SINGLE PURPOSE ENTITY REQUIREMENTS

 

Section 3.01 Formation and Existence. Mortgagor hereby makes the following representations, warranties, and covenants.

 

(a)            Mortgagor Formation and Existence. Mortgagor is a Single Purpose Entity (as hereinafter defined) and shall remain a Single Purpose Entity at all times until the Loan has been repaid in full.

 

(b)            Organization Documents of Mortgagor. The organizational documents of Mortgagor shall contain all representations, warranties, covenants, and definitions contained in this Article III and shall not, without Mortgagee’s prior written consent, be amended, rescinded, or revoked until the Loan is paid in full.

 

Section 3.02 Separateness Covenants and Requirements.

 

(a)            Mortgagor Criteria. With respect to Mortgagor, the term “Single Purpose Entity” means a corporation, limited partnership, or limited liability company, which at all times since its formation and thereafter until the Loan has been repaid in full shall meet the following requirements:

 

(i)             Is and shall remain organized solely for the purpose of owning, operating, and managing the Property and transacting such lawful business as may be incidental, necessary, or appropriate thereto.

 

(ii)           Has not engaged and shall not engage in any business unrelated to the activities set forth in Section 3.02(a)(i).

 

(iii)          Has not owned and shall not own any real property other than the Property.

 

7


 

 

 

(iv)          Has not owned and shall not own any assets, other than the Property and Personal Property necessary or incidental to its ownership, operation, and management of the Property.

 

(v)           Intentionally omitted.

 

(vi)          If such entity is a single-member limited liability company such entity shall:

 

(A)            be a Delaware limited liability company;

 

(B)            intentionally omitted.

 

(C)            not take any bankruptcy-related action and not cause or permit the members or managers of such entity to take any bankruptcy-related action; and

 

(D)            have a natural Person or an entity that is not a member of the company, that has signed its limited liability company agreement and that, under the terms of such limited liability company agreement, becomes a member of the company immediately prior to the withdrawal or dissolution of the last remaining member of the company.

 

As used herein, the term “Affiliate” means, with respect to any Person: (a) any other Person which, directly or indirectly, is in Control of, is Controlled by, or is under common Control with, such Person; (b) any other Person who is a director or officer of (i) such Person, (ii) any subsidiary of such Person, or (iii) any Person described in clause (a); or (c) any corporation, limited liability company, or partnership which has as a director any Person described in clause (b).

 

As used herein, the term “Control” means the possession, directly or indirectly, of the power to direct or cause the direction of the management and policies of a Person whether through ownership, voting rights, beneficial interest, by contract, or by any other means. This definition shall be construed to apply equally to variations of the defined term, including terms such as “Controlled,” “Controlling,” or “Controlled by.”

 

(vii)         Intentionally omitted.

 

(viii)        Has and shall preserve its existence as an entity duly organized, validly existing, and in good standing under the laws of the jurisdiction of its formation or organization, as the case may be.

 

(ix)           Has observed and shall observe all partnership, corporate, or limited liability company formalities, as applicable.

 

(x)            Has not and shall not amend its organizational documents in a manner that would violate the requirements of this Article III.

 

8


(xi)           Has not and shall not merge or consolidate with any other Person.

 

(xii)          Has not taken, and shall not take, any action to:

 

(A)            dissolve, wind up, terminate, or liquidate;

 

(B)            sell, transfer, or otherwise dispose of all or substantially all its assets; or

 

(C)            change its legal structure (other than in connection with a Permitted Transfer (as hereinafter defined)), or permit the direct or indirect transfer of any partnership, membership, or other Equity Interests, as applicable, other than a Permitted Transfer.

 

As used herein, the term “Equity Interests” means, as applicable: (a) partnership interests (whether general or limited) in an entity which is a partnership; (b) membership interests in an entity which is a limited liability company; or (c) the shares of stock interests in an entity which is a corporation.

 

(xiii)         Has not and shall not, without the unanimous written consent of all Mortgagor’s partners, members, or shareholders, as applicable:

 

(A)           file or consent to the filing of any petition, either voluntary or involuntary, availing itself of any insolvency, bankruptcy, liquidation, or reorganization statute;

 

(B)            seek or consent to the appointment of a receiver, liquidator, or similar fiduciary; or

 

(C)            make an assignment for the benefit of creditors.

 

(xiv)        Has not formed, acquired, or held and shall not form, acquire, or hold any subsidiary.

 

(xv)         Has held and shall hold its assets in its own name.

 

(xvi)        Has not commingled and shall not commingle its funds or assets with those of any other Person and has not assigned and shall not assign its interest in Leases and Rents to any other Person.

 

(xvii)       Has not incurred and shall not incur any debt, secured or unsecured, direct or contingent, other than (A) the Loan, (B) the Senior Indebtedness (as defined in the hereinafter-defined Intercreditor Agreement), (C) any Permitted Additional Financing (as hereinafter defined), and (D) customary unsecured trade payables incurred in the ordinary course of owning and operating the Property and as otherwise approved in writing by Mortgagee. As used herein, “Permitted Additional Financing” means any loan or other financing secured by a second priority mortgage and security interest in the Property or any interest therein (“Outside Financing”), provided that: (v) Mortgagor has provided Mortgagee with not less than fifteen (15) Business Days’ prior written notice of such Outside Financing, together with copies of all material documentation related thereto; (w) any such Outside Financing shall be subordinate in all respects to the Loan Documents; (x) the lender providing such Outside Financing (the “Junior Lender”) shall have entered into a commercially reasonable form of intercreditor agreement with Mortgagee pursuant to which the Junior Lender agrees that its claim on the Property is secondary to Mortgagee’s claim; (y) no monetary default or any other Event of Default has occurred and is continuing at the time such Outside Financing is incurred; and (z) Mortgagor remains in compliance with all covenants under the Loan Documents after giving effect to such Outside Financing.

9


 

 

(xviii)      Has maintained and shall maintain its records, books of account, bank accounts, financial statements, accounting records, and other entity documents separate and apart from those of any other Person; and in connection with any of its financial statements:

 

(A)            has shown and shall show its assets and liabilities separate and apart from those of any other Person;

 

(B)            has not permitted and shall not permit its assets to be listed as assets on the financial statement of any of its Affiliates except as required by generally accepted accounting principles (“GAAP”); provided, however, that any such consolidated financial statement contains a note indicating that its separate assets and credit are not available to pay the debts of such Affiliate and that its liabilities do not constitute obligations of the consolidated entity; and

 

(C)            has listed and shall list such assets on its balance sheet, as applicable.

 

(xix)         Other than capital contributions and distributions authorized under the terms of its organizational documents, has not entered into or been a party to, and shall not enter into or be a party to, any contract, agreement, or transaction with any of its partners, members, shareholders, principals, or Affiliates except in the ordinary course of its business and on commercially reasonable terms comparable to those of an arm’s-length transaction with an unrelated third party.

 

(xx)          Has not acquired and shall not acquire obligations or securities of its partners, members, or shareholders or any other owner or Affiliate.

 

(xxi)         Has maintained and shall maintain its assets in such a manner that it shall not be costly or difficult to segregate, ascertain, or identify its individual assets from those of any other Person.

 

10


 

 

 

(xxii)        Has not assumed, guaranteed, or become obligated and shall not assume, guarantee, or become obligated for the debts of any other Person, except as provided by the Loan Documents.

 

(xxiii)       Has not pledged its assets or held out its credit and shall not pledge its assets or hold out its credit as being available to satisfy the obligations of any other Person, except as provided by the Loan Documents or in connection with any Permitted Additional Financing.

 

(xxiv)       Has not made and shall not make any loans or advances to any other Person.

 

(xxv)       To the extent required under Applicable Law, has filed and shall file its own income tax returns, except to the extent that it is required by law to file consolidated tax returns.

 

(xxvi)       Has held itself out and shall hold itself out as a separate and distinct entity under its own name (or in a name franchised or licensed to it) and not as a division or part of any other Person.

 

(xxvii)      Has corrected and shall correct any known misunderstanding regarding its separate identity.

 

(xxviii)      After deducting Operating Expenses (as hereinafter defined) from operating income generated by the Property, Mortgagor:

 

(A)            has remained and shall remain solvent;

 

(B)            has paid and shall pay its debts and liabilities from its assets as the same become due; and

 

(C)            has maintained and shall maintain adequate capital for the normal obligations reasonably foreseeable in a business of its size and character and in light of its contemplated business operations.

 

(xxix)        Has maintained and used and shall maintain and use separate stationery, invoices, and checks bearing its own name and not bearing the name of any other entity unless such entity is clearly designated an agent.

 

(xxx)         Has fairly and reasonably allocated and shall fairly and reasonably allocate any expenses or obligations that are shared with any Affiliates, constituents, owners, or guarantors (including Guarantor), or any Affiliate of any of the foregoing, including, but not limited to, paying for shared office space and for services performed by any employee of any of them.

 

(xxxi)        Has paid and shall pay its own liabilities and expenses, including the salaries of its own employees, out of its own funds and assets.

 

11


 

 

 

As used herein, “Operating Expenses” means all cash expenses actually incurred by or charged to Mortgagor (appropriately prorated for expenses that, although actually incurred in a particular period, also relate to other reporting periods), with respect to the ownership, operation, leasing, and management of the Property in the ordinary course of business, determined in accordance with GAAP or other method approved by Mortgagee and as adjusted by Mortgagee in accordance with its customary underwriting procedures and policies then in effect. The term Operating Expenses shall specifically exclude, however: (a) costs of tenant improvements and leasing commissions; (b) capital expenditures; (c) depreciation; (d) principal payments made under the Loan; (e) costs of restoration following a Casualty or Condemnation (as those terms are hereinafter defined); and (f) any other noncash items.

Section 5.03 Insurance Coverages. Mortgagor shall obtain and maintain at its own expense during the term of the Loan such insurance coverages (including the policy type, minimum coverage amounts, maximum deductibles, and acceptable exclusions) as Mortgagor shall deem reasonably necessary considering, among other things, the location, use, and occupancy of the Property and shall comply with all terms, covenants, and obligations in Article VII with respect to any proceeds thereof in the event of a Casualty or Condemnation. Mortgagee reserves the right to periodically review and modify the insurance requirements hereunder in Mortgagee’s reasonable discretion, provided that any such modifications shall be consistent with insurance requirements for comparable properties in the same geographic area. As of May 26, 2026, Mortgagor acknowledges and agrees it shall maintain the insurance coverages set forth in this Section 5.03, subject to Mortgagee’s right to amend any insurance coverages required hereunder in accordance with the foregoing.

 

(a)            Property Insurance. Mortgagor shall maintain (or cause each Tenant to maintain, as applicable) comprehensive property insurance under one or more insurance policies insuring against the perils of fire, water, wind, burglary, theft, malicious mischief, riot, civil commotion, vandalism, and any other peril now or hereafter covered under a “causes of loss-special form” policy. Each policy shall include the endorsements required hereunder and shall comply with all covenants contained herein.

 

(i)            Full Replacement Value Endorsement. Such policy or policies shall insure the Improvements and Personal Property in an amount equal to one hundred percent (100.00%) of full replacement cost, without taking into account depreciation, as reasonably determined by Mortgagee from time to time. Mortgagee may, at any time and from time to time, upon reasonable advance notice to Mortgagor, increase the coverage requirements under this Section 5.03 to reflect increases to the full replacement cost of the Improvements and Personal Property as determined by Mortgagee. In making its determination, Mortgagee may rely on a qualified, independent appraiser or engineer.

 

(ii)            Boiler and Machinery Insurance. Mortgagor shall maintain comprehensive boiler and machinery insurance and systems breakdown coverage (without exclusion for explosion), insuring all boilers, turbines, engines, or other pressure vessels, and machinery and equipment (including heating, ventilation, and air-conditioning equipment, refrigeration equipment, sprinkler systems, electrical systems, pipes, conduits, and similar machinery and components) located in or servicing the Property. The coverage under such boiler and machinery insurance shall be in such amount per accident equal to one hundred percent (100.00%) of full replacement cost (as reasonably determined and adjusted from time to time by Mortgagee). Such insurance shall also provide coverage against business interruption and loss of income or use arising from the Casualty. The policy shall name Mortgagee as an additional insured under a standard joint loss clause and shall provide that all proceeds be paid to Mortgagee.

 

24


 

 

 

(iii)          Business Interruption or Loss of Rental Income Insurance. Mortgagor shall maintain business interruption insurance, with loss payable to Mortgagee, insuring against lost Rents resulting from any insured peril. Coverage shall be on an “as loss sustained” basis in an amount equal to one hundred percent (100.00%) of the income (as herein defined) for the Property for a period of not less than twelve (12) months from the date of casualty, with a twelve (12)-month extended period of indemnity. The amount of coverage as of the Effective Date shall be determined by Mortgagee and adjusted at least once each year based on a reasonable estimate of projected gross Rent for the next ensuing twelve (12)-month period. Mortgagee may hold and apply all proceeds paid under such policy as permitted under the Loan Documents. For purposes of this coverage, “income” means the sum of the total, then ascertainable Rents payable under each Lease, and the total ascertainable amount of all other payments to be received by Mortgagor from third parties which are the legal obligation of the Property’s Tenants, occupants, and licensees, reduced to the extent such amounts would not be received because of operating expenses not incurred during the period that any portion of the Property cannot be occupied as a result of the Casualty.

 

(b)            Commercial General Liability Insurance. Mortgagor shall maintain (or shall cause each Tenant to maintain as applicable) commercial general liability insurance coverage with “products and completed operations coverage,” insuring against bodily injury, death, and property damage, including all legal liability to the extent insurable and all court costs, legal fees, and expenses arising out of, or connected with, the possession, use, leasing, operation, maintenance, or condition of the Property in such amounts as may be required by Mortgagee from time to time, but in no event less than One Million and 00/100 Dollars ($1,000,000.00) per occurrence and Two Million and 00/100 Dollars ($2,000,000.00) in the annual aggregate (and, if on a blanket policy, containing an “Aggregate Per Location” endorsement) and with umbrella or excess liability insurance in an amount not less than Five Million and No/100 Dollars ($5,000,000.00) per occurrence on terms consistent with the commercial general liability insurance policy required. The policy must name Mortgagee as an additional insured.

 

(c)            Additional Insurance Coverage Requirements. Without limiting the foregoing, Mortgagor shall maintain the following additional insurance coverages, if applicable, in such amounts and with such deductibles as provided below (or if not so provided, as determined by Mortgagee in its reasonable discretion), including:

 

(i)            Ordinance or Law Coverage if any part of the Improvements is or shall later become a legal nonconforming use under Applicable Law with a coverage amount of $100,000.

 

(ii)            Intentionally omitted.

 

25


 

 

 

(iii)          Workers’ compensation insurance for all employees employed at the Property which, if applicable, can be purchased on an “if any” basis. All coverage and coverage limits shall be in compliance with the laws of New York State.

 

(iv)          Motor vehicles liability insurance for all owned and non-owned automobile liability on an “if any” basis insuring against liability occurring on or about the Property or arising from the use of the Property.

 

(v)            Builder’s risk insurance during any period of construction, renovation, or alteration of the Improvements, such insurance to not be less than one hundred percent (100.00%) of the full replacement cost value of the existing Improvements; provided, however, that as of the Effective Date, such coverage shall not be required.

 

(vi)          Intentionally omitted.

 

(vii)        Intentionally omitted.

 

(viii)        Any other insurance Mortgagee reasonably deems necessary to cover any other insurable hazards with respect to the Property whether now known or later discovered, and any replacements, substitutions, or additions to any of the coverages required hereunder, provided that such insurance is customary for comparable properties in the same geographic area.

 

(d)            Policy Prohibitions. No policy shall:

 

(i)            Exclude coverage for windstorm damage and, if such coverage is limited after a storm is named, such policies shall contain a “Named Storm Endorsement”; provided, however, that notwithstanding the foregoing, Mortgagor’s existing coverage with a two percent (2.00%) deductible and $50,000 minimum for wind and named storm coverage is acceptable to Mortgagee.

 

(ii)           Permit Mortgagor or Mortgagee to become a co-insurer within the terms of the applicable policy; or

 

(iii)          Except as otherwise expressly provided herein, have a deductible exceeding One Hundred Thousand and No/100 ($100,000.00).

 

(e)           Qualified Insurers. All insurance shall be issued under valid and enforceable policies issued by one or more domestic insurers authorized to issue insurance in New York having a minimum rating of A-/VII rating by A.M. Best Company and acceptable to Mortgagee in its reasonable discretion. Mortgagee’s approval of the insurer or the insurance coverage is not a representation or warranty concerning the sufficiency of any coverage.

 

(f)            Policy Requirements. All policies shall be for a term of not less than one (1) year and, unless indicated to the contrary herein, shall insure and name Mortgagee as beneficiary under a so-called “standard mortgagee clause.” Each policy shall provide coverage that: (i) prohibits cancellation or termination before the policy’s expiration date; (ii) permits recovery by Mortgagee notwithstanding any defense to claims that may be available to the insurer due to the acts or omissions of Mortgagor; (iii) permits proceeds to be directly payable to Mortgagee; (iv) entitles Mortgagee to at least ten (10) days prior written notice of cancellation for nonpayment of premiums and at least thirty (30) days prior written notice of nonrenewal or modification; and (v) contains a waiver of subrogation endorsement as to Mortgagee. If the required insurance coverage is provided under a blanket policy covering the Property and other properties or assets not secured by this Loan, such blanket policy must specify the portion of total coverage that is allocated to the Property and any sublimit in such blanket policy which is applicable to the Property. A blanket policy shall comply in all other respects with the requirements of this Section  5.03.

26


 

 

 

(g)           Evidence of Insurance. Mortgagor shall deliver to Mortgagee evidence of the insurance coverages required under this Section 5.03, together with proof of payment for the first year’s premiums, upon the request of Mortgagee and not less than thirty (30) days before the expiration date of each policy. All evidence of insurance coverage shall be in form and substance reasonably satisfactory to Mortgagee. All evidence of insurance shall accurately reflect the coverages available under each such policy and shall satisfy all requirements hereunder. Mortgagee shall have the right at any time and from time to time to require further assurances from the insurer or its agent regarding the effectiveness of any policy and the coverages provided therein.

 

(h)           Mortgagee’s Right to Obtain Insurance. If Mortgagor fails to obtain or maintain the insurance coverages required hereunder or shall fail to provide Mortgagee satisfactory evidence of all required insurance coverages, and if Mortgagor fails to cure such deficiency within five (5) Business Days after notice from Mortgagee of such deficiency, an Event of Default shall be deemed to have occurred upon which no further notice or right of cure shall be available to Mortgagor. Upon such Event of Default, Mortgagee shall have the right to obtain all required insurance not provided by Mortgagor. All amounts advanced by Mortgagee to procure such insurance shall be added to the principal amount secured by this Mortgage and bear interest at the Default Rate. As used herein and in the Loan Documents, the “Default Rate” shall have the meaning given to such term under the Notes. Mortgagee shall have no liability for the performance of any insurer selected or approved by Mortgagee.

ARTICLE VII 

CASUALTY AND CONDEMNATION

 

If the Property, or any portion thereof, shall be damaged or destroyed by Casualty or become subject to any Condemnation, the terms, covenants, and conditions of this Article VII shall apply. As used in the Loan Documents, the term “Casualty” means the occurrence of damage or destruction to the Property, or any part thereof, by fire, flood, vandalism, windstorm, hurricane, earthquake, acts of terrorism, or any other peril; and the term “Condemnation” means the taking by any governmental authority of the Property or any part thereof through eminent domain or otherwise, including any transfer made in lieu of or in anticipation of the exercise or threatened exercise of such taking.

 

Section 7.01 Provisions Applicable to Casualty and Condemnation.

 

(a)            Obligation to Notify Mortgagee. Mortgagor shall promptly notify Mortgagee, in writing, of any actual or threatened Condemnation or of any Casualty that damages or renders the Property or any material part thereof unusable.

 

(b)            Mortgagee Consent Required. Mortgagor shall not make any agreement in lieu of Condemnation or accept any insurance proceeds with respect to a Casualty without Mortgagee’s prior written consent, such consent not to be unreasonably withheld or delayed so long as no Event of Default has occurred or is continuing. Mortgagor shall provide Mortgagee with copies of all notices or filings made or received by Mortgagor in connection with any Casualty or Condemnation or with respect to collection of any insurance proceeds or Condemnation award, as applicable.

 

(c)            Payment and Trust Provisions. So long as an Event of Default has occurred and is continuing, Mortgagor hereby grants Mortgagee the authority, at Mortgagee’s option either to settle and adjust any claim arising with respect to the Casualty or Condemnation without Mortgagor’s consent, or to allow Mortgagor to settle and adjust such claim; provided that, in either case, the insurance proceeds or Condemnation award, as applicable, is paid directly to Mortgagee. At all times when no Event of Default has occurred and is continuing, Mortgagor shall have the right to settle and adjust any claim arising with respect to the Casualty or Condemnation, subject to Mortgagee’s approval, not to be unreasonably withheld or delayed. If any portion of the insurance proceeds or Condemnation award, as applicable, shall be payable to Mortgagee, but shall have been paid to Mortgagor, then subject to the foregoing, Mortgagor shall hold such amounts in trust for the benefit of Mortgagee to the extent required hereby and shall promptly remit such amounts to Mortgagee.

 

32


 

 

 

(d)            Continuing Loan Obligations. Notwithstanding that a Casualty or Condemnation has occurred, or that rights to a Condemnation award or insurance proceeds are pending, no Casualty or Condemnation shall be deemed to excuse any payment obligations of Mortgagor hereunder and Mortgagor shall continue to pay the Debt and other payment obligations under the Loan Documents in strict accordance with the terms of the Notes and other Loan Documents.

 

(e)            Payment of Mortgagee’s Expenses. All expenses incurred by Mortgagee in the settlement and collection of amounts paid with respect to a Casualty or Condemnation (including reasonable legal fees and expenses) and with respect to the administering the repair and restoration as provided in Section 7.01(f) shall be deducted from such amounts and reimbursed to Mortgagee prior to any application as provided hereunder. As used in the Loan Documents, the term “Restoration Proceeds” means any insurance proceeds or Condemnation awards paid or payable on account of a Casualty or Condemnation, as applicable (including any business interruption insurance proceeds) less Mortgagee’s reimbursable expenses as provided in this Section 7.01(e).

 

(f)            Mortgagor Obligation to Repair and Restore. If Mortgagee makes Restoration Proceeds available to Mortgagor, Mortgagor shall use commercially reasonable efforts to diligently repair and restore the Property to at least equal value and substantially the same character as existed immediately prior to such Casualty or Condemnation. All plans and specifications for the repair and restoration and all contractors, subcontractors, and materialmen to be engaged in the repair and restoration, as well as the contracts under which they have been engaged, shall be subject to Mortgagee’s prior review and written approval, not to be unreasonably withheld, conditioned, or delayed. Mortgagee may engage, at Mortgagor’s reasonable expense, an independent engineer or inspector to assist Mortgagee in its review of any requests and to inspect the Property while work is in progress and at completion, which reasonable amounts can be deducted from insurance proceeds and condemnation awards as provided in Section 7.01(e).

 

33


 

 

 

Section 7.02 Casualty.

 

(a)            Release of Restoration Proceeds for Casualty. If the Property shall be damaged or destroyed, in whole or in part, by any Casualty, then provided that insurance proceeds shall be received by Mortgagee as provided in Section 7.01(c) and provided, further that all conditions precedent set out in Section 7.02(b) shall be satisfied in Mortgagee’s reasonable judgment, then, such proceeds shall be held by Mortgagee in a trust fund used to fund the Property’s repair and restoration. In such event, Mortgagee shall disburse Restoration Proceeds for the repair and reconstruction of the Property on an “as work progresses” basis in accordance with customary construction lending requisition criteria and retainages. In no event shall the lien hereunder be reduced, except to the extent and by the amount of which Restoration Proceeds are applied to the Debt or in payment of any other Obligation as provided herein. Provided no Event of Default shall have occurred and be continuing, said trust fund shall be interest-bearing and interest, if any, shall be paid or credited to Mortgagor.

 

(b)            Conditions Precedent to Release of Restoration Proceeds for Casualty. The following conditions precedent shall apply to any release of Restoration Proceeds by Mortgagee in connection with any Casualty:

 

(i)            Restoration Proceeds in respect of the Casualty are sufficient to restore the Property to substantially the same condition that existed prior to the Casualty.

 

(ii)           In Mortgagee’s commercially reasonable determination, restoration can be completed no later than the earliest of:

 

(A)            twelve (12) months from the date the Casualty occurred or the expiration of Mortgagor’s business interruption insurance, whichever is earlier;

 

(B)            the earliest date by which completion is required under the applicable Lease; or

 

(C)            the earliest date by which completion is required under Applicable Law to preserve the right to rebuild the Improvements as they existed prior to the Casualty.

 

(c)            Application of Restoration Proceeds for Casualty to the Obligations. If at any time any condition precedent of Section 7.02(b) is not met, then Mortgagee may apply Restoration Proceeds to the Obligations. No prepayment penalty or premium shall be applicable to any such application.

 

(d)            Payment of Surplus Restoration Proceeds for Casualty. Provided no Event of Default shall be then existing, any excess Restoration Proceeds in respect of a Casualty after completion of all repairs and restoration shall, at Mortgagee’s option to be exercised in its good faith, commercially reasonable discretion, either be released to Mortgagor or shall continue to be held pursuant hereto to pay any shortfall to Property operating expenses.

 

34


 

 

 

Section 7.03 Condemnation.

 

(a)            Application of Restoration Proceeds for Condemnation. In the event of a Condemnation other than a Partial Condemnation, Mortgagee shall apply the Restoration Proceeds pursuant to Section 7.03(d). As used in the Loan Documents, the term “Partial Condemnation” means a taking by Condemnation affecting less than ten percent (10.00%) of the Land and no portion of the Improvements and, as to the Land taken, such Land must only be along the perimeter of the Property.

 

(b)            Release of Restoration Proceeds for Partial Condemnation. In the event of a Partial Condemnation and provided that the condemnation award shall be received by Mortgagee pursuant to Section 7.01(c) and all conditions precedent set out in Section  7.03(c) are satisfied in Mortgagee’s reasonable judgment, then, such proceeds shall be held by Mortgagee in a trust fund used to fund the Property’s repair and restoration. Mortgagee shall disburse Restoration Proceeds for the repair and reconstruction of the Property that is subject to Partial Condemnation on an “as work progresses” basis in accordance with customary construction lending requisition criteria and retainages. In no event shall the lien hereunder be reduced, except to the extent and by the amount of which Restoration Proceeds are applied to the Debt or in payment of any other Obligation as provided herein. Provided no Event of Default shall have occurred and be continuing (beyond any applicable notice and cure period), said trust fund shall be interest-bearing and interest, if any, shall be paid or credited to Mortgagor.

 

(c)            Conditions Precedent to Release of Restoration Proceeds for Partial Condemnation. The following conditions precedent shall apply to any release of Restoration Proceeds in connection with any Partial Condemnation:

 

(i)            No Event of Default shall have occurred and be continuing (beyond any applicable notice and cure periods) under the Loan.

 

(ii)            Restoration Proceeds in respect of the Partial Condemnation are sufficient to restore the Property to substantially the same condition that existed prior to the Partial Condemnation.

 

(iii)            In Mortgagee’s commercially reasonable determination, restoration can be completed no later than the earlier of:

 

(A)            Six (6) months from the date the Partial Condemnation occurred; or

 

(B)            the earliest date by which completion is required under Applicable Law to preserve the right to rebuild the Improvements as they existed prior to the Partial Condemnation.

 

(d)            Application of Restoration Proceeds for Condemnation. In the event of a Condemnation other than a Partial Condemnation, or if at any time any condition precedent of Section 7.03(c) is not satisfied, then Mortgagee may apply Restoration Proceeds to the Obligations. No prepayment penalty or premium shall be applicable to any such application. Any excess Condemnation award remaining in the trust fund after the completion of all repairs and restoration undertaken pursuant to Section 7.03(b) shall be applied to the Obligations.

ARTICLE IX

EVENTS OF DEFAULT; REMEDIES

 

Section 9.01 Events of Default. The occurrence of any one or more of the following events shall constitute an “Event of Default” under this Mortgage and the Loan:

 

(a)            Payment Default. If Mortgagor shall fail to pay within five (5) Business Days after such payment is due, subject to any applicable notice and cure period, any payment required to be made by Mortgagor under this Mortgage, any Note, or any other Loan Document.

 

(b)            Maturity Default. If unpaid principal, accrued but unpaid interest, and all other amounts outstanding under the Loan are not paid in full on or before the Maturity Date, time being of the essence.

 

(c)            Cross-Default. If a material “Event of Default” (as that term is defined in the applicable Loan Documents) occurs under any other Loan Document or a default beyond applicable notice and cure periods occurs with respect to any Affiliate Lease Agreement.

 

(d)            False Representation or Warranty. If any representation or warranty made by Mortgagor or Guarantor in any of the Loan Documents, or in any certificate, report, financial statement, or other instrument or document furnished to Mortgagee in connection with the Loan or in any request hereafter made for Mortgagee’s consent shall be false or misleading in any material respect.

 

(e)            Insolvency, Bankruptcy, and Debtor Relief.

 

(i)            Admission of Insolvency. If Mortgagor or Guarantor shall admit in writing its inability to pay its debts as they become due, make an assignment for the benefit of creditors, or generally not pay its debts as they become due.

 

(ii)           Voluntary Bankruptcy and Debtor Relief. If Mortgagor or Guarantor shall commence any case, proceeding, or other action under any existing or future law of any jurisdiction, domestic or foreign, relating to bankruptcy, insolvency, reorganization, conservatorship, or relief of debtors seeking to have an order for relief entered with respect to it, or seeking to adjudicate it as bankrupt or insolvent, or seeking reorganization, arrangement, adjustment, winding-up, liquidation, dissolution, composition, or other relief with respect to it or its debts, or seeking appointment of a receiver, trustee, custodian, conservators, or other similar official for it or for all or any substantial part of its assets.

 

37


 

 

 

(iii)            Involuntary Bankruptcy. If there shall be commenced against Mortgagor or Guarantor any case, proceeding, or other action of a nature referred to in subsection (e)(ii) above by any party other than Mortgagee which results in the entry of an order for relief or any such adjudication or appointment or remains undismissed, undischarged, or unbonded for a period of sixty (60) days.

 

(f)            Attachment or Distraint. If there shall be commenced against Mortgagor or Guarantor any case, proceeding, or other action seeking issuance of a warrant of attachment, execution, distraint, or similar process against all or a substantial part of the Property which results in the entry of an order for any such relief which shall not have been vacated, discharged, stayed, or bonded pending appeal within sixty (60) days from the entry thereof.

 

(g)            Judgments and Liens. If any judgment for monetary damages is entered against Mortgagor or Guarantor or if any Lien other than a Permitted Encumbrance is filed against the Property which, in Mortgagee’s reasonable judgment, has a Material Adverse Effect or is not covered to Mortgagee’s reasonable satisfaction by collectible insurance proceeds. As used in the Loan Documents, the term “Material Adverse Effect” means, with respect to any circumstance, act, condition, or event of whatever nature, including determinations made in any litigation, arbitration, or governmental investigation or proceeding, whether singly or in conjunction with any other event, act, condition, or circumstances, whether or not related, which in Mortgagee’s reasonable judgment causes a material change or adverse effect upon: (i) the business, operations, prospects, or financial condition of Mortgagor or Guarantor; (ii) the ability of either Mortgagor or Guarantor to perform its Obligations under any Loan Document to which it is a party; (iii) the use, value, or condition of the Property; (iv) the compliance of the Property with any Applicable Law; or (v) the validity, priority, or enforceability of any Loan Document or the liens, rights, or remedies of Mortgagee thereunder, including recourse against the Property.

 

(h)            Transfer Violation. If a Transfer shall occur in violation of Article VIII or in violation of any terms and conditions contained in Mortgagee’s consent to a Transfer.

 

(i)            Insurance Default. If Mortgagor fails to obtain, pay for or timely deliver evidence of the insurance coverages required under the Loan and such failure continues for thirty (30) days after written notice from Mortgagee.

 

(j)            Taxes Default. If any Taxes are not paid when due and payable.

 

38


 

 

 

(k)            Violating Formation and Existence Requirements. If Mortgagor or Guarantor shall:

 

(i)              Dissolve or fail to remain in good standing in each of their respective state of formation;

 

(ii)             Fail to remain authorized to do business in New York if required under this Mortgage; or

 

(iii)            Breach any covenant contained in Article III.

 

(l)             Prohibited Action in Respect of Leases. If Mortgagor breaches any covenant contained in Section 5.02.

 

(m)           Other Defaults. Except to the extent otherwise specifically set forth in this Mortgage or other Loan Document, if any other default shall occur which is not cured:

 

(i)            In the case of any default which can be cured by the payment of a sum of money, within ten (10) Business Days after written notice from Mortgagee to Mortgagor; or

 

(ii)            In the case of any other default, within thirty (30) days after written notice from Mortgagee to Mortgagor, except that if said default cannot be cured within such time period and provided that Mortgagor is diligently pursuing a cure and no other Event of Default is then existing, then, Mortgagor shall have an additional reasonable period to effect a cure, but in no event shall the entire cure period be more than ninety (90) days.

 

Section 9.02 Mortgagee’s Remedies. Upon the occurrence and during the continuance of an Event of Default, in addition to all other rights, remedies, and powers of Mortgagee at law or in equity, all of which Mortgagee hereby reserves, Mortgagee may take any action described in this Section 9.02 to the fullest extent permitted by law. Any and all actions taken hereunder may be pursued by Mortgagee in its own name or in the name of Mortgagee’s nominee, without notice or demand of any kind, except as otherwise expressly provided in the Loan Documents or by Applicable Law. To the extent permitted by Applicable Law, Mortgagee may exercise all rights, remedies, and powers at such time and in such manner as Mortgagee determines in its discretion, including exercising one or more remedies concurrently, without impairing or adversely affecting any other rights, remedies, and powers granted or reserved hereunder.

 

(a)            Entry and Possession. Mortgagee shall have the right to enter upon and take possession of the Property, and dispossess and exclude Mortgagor, its agents, and servants by summary proceedings or otherwise. In furtherance hereof, Mortgagee shall have all rights granted at law or in equity to mortgagees-in-possession, including taking possession of all books, records, and accounts relating to the Property; using, operating, managing, and controlling the Property and every part thereof; and entering into, enforcing, and modifying Leases and Property Agreements.

 

39


 

 

 

(b)            Protective Advances. Mortgagee shall have the right to make any payments or incur any expenses that Mortgagee shall reasonably determine are necessary to protect or preserve the Property and Mortgagee’s Lien and security interests therein. In furtherance of this right, Mortgagor hereby authorizes Mortgagee to make such payments and to incur such expenses in Mortgagee’s reasonable discretion to the extent reasonably necessary to protect or preserve the Property and Mortgagee’s security interests therein. All reasonable and documented amounts paid by Mortgagee hereunder shall be secured by this Mortgage and added to the Obligations with interest thereon at the Applicable Interest Rate (or, during the continuance of an Event of Default, the Default Rate) from the date of payment until repayment in full. Mortgagee shall be subrogated to the rights of Mortgagor, if any, under any contract or agreement paid, or any debt or Lien discharged, by a protective advance made by Mortgagee pursuant to this Section 9.02(b).

 

(c)            Acceleration. Mortgagee may declare all Obligations immediately due, payable, and collectible, regardless of maturity, and, upon such event, all Obligations shall become, without further presentment, protest, notice or demand (all of which presentment, protest, notice and demand Borrower expressly waives) immediately due, payable, and collectible (provided, that, upon the occurrence of any Event of Default described in Section 9.01(d), all Obligations shall automatically become immediately due and payable without further presentment, protest, notice or demand (all of which presentment, protest, notice and demand Borrower expressly waives)); and thereupon Mortgagee may exercise all rights and remedies granted hereunder or at law, with or without notice to Mortgagor, including instituting any proceedings to foreclose this Mortgage, by judicial action or by any other action permitted hereunder or by Applicable Law. No prepayment penalty or premium shall be due in connection with any acceleration of the Loan.

 

(d)            Foreclosure. Mortgagee may, with or without taking possession of the Property, institute a foreclosure proceeding in accordance with Article 13 of the New York Real Property Actions and Proceedings Law or any other Applicable Law in effect on the date foreclosure is commenced, or take any other action as may be allowed, at law or in equity, for the complete or partial foreclosure of this Mortgage to the full extent permitted by law. Mortgagee may bid at any foreclosure sale and may purchase the Property in such proceedings. If Mortgagee shall be the winning bidder at a foreclosure sale, then, in lieu of paying cash, Mortgagee may satisfy all or a portion of the purchase bid by taking a credit against the bid amount for any outstanding Debt then due Mortgagee, including the costs and expenses of enforcing the Obligations, up to the aggregate outstanding Debt then due.

 

(e)            Deficiency Judgment. Except as otherwise provided in the Loan Documents or by Applicable Law, Mortgagee may sue for and obtain a judgment for any deficiency remaining with respect to the Obligations after applying all amounts received by Mortgagee in furtherance of the exercise of its rights to enforce this Mortgage as provided in this Section 9.02.

 

(f)            UCC Foreclosure and Other Rights. With respect to any Personal Property, Mortgagee may exercise all rights, remedies, and powers accruing to Mortgagee under the Loan Documents, the NY UCC, or any other remedy available at law or in equity. In furtherance thereof, Mortgagee may take possession of any Personal Property and take such measures as Mortgagee deems necessary for the care, protection, and preservation of such Personal Property. Mortgagee shall have the right to require Mortgagor, at its sole expense, to assemble any Personal Property and make it available to Mortgagee at such time and place as Mortgagee may direct. In exercising the right to sell any Personal Property pursuant to the NY UCC, Mortgagor hereby agrees that ten (10) Business Days’ prior written notice of such action shall constitute reasonable advance notice to Mortgagor.

 

40


 

 

 

(g)            Appointment of Receiver. Mortgagee may apply for the appointment of a receiver of Mortgagor, the Rents, or the Property, or any of the foregoing, without notice to Mortgagor. Except as may be required by Applicable Law, Mortgagee shall be entitled to the appointment of a receiver as a matter of right, without consideration of the value of the Property securing the Debt, or the solvency of any Person liable for the payment of such amounts. Mortgagor hereby consents to such appointment, whether during the pendency of a foreclosure proceeding or otherwise, and waives notice of any application therefor, unless notice is expressly required by Applicable Law.

 

(h)            Right to Sue. Mortgagee may, from time to time, take any legal action permitted by Applicable Law to recover any sums due under the Loan Documents, without regard to whether the Loan has been accelerated, or whether foreclosure and any other enforcement action has been commenced. Mortgagee may exercise this right without prejudicing Mortgagee’s right to concurrently take any other enforcement action, including foreclosure.

 

(i)             No Obligation to Marshal Assets. In exercising its rights and remedies under this Mortgage, Mortgagee shall have no obligation to marshal assets or to realize upon all the Property. Mortgagor hereby waives any right to have any of the Property marshaled in connection with any sale or other exercise of Mortgagee’s rights, remedies, and powers hereunder.

 

Section 9.03 Omnibus Provisions Pertaining to Mortgagee’s Rights and Remedies.

 

(a)            Remedies Cumulative. The rights, powers, and remedies of Mortgagee hereunder are separate, distinct, and cumulative with all other rights, powers, and remedies of Mortgagee in the other Loan Documents, at law, or in equity, each of which may be exercised independently, concurrently, and successively in Mortgagee’s discretion. Mortgagee’s election of any right, power, or remedy shall not be deemed exclusive of any other and shall not bar or limit the exercise of any other right, power, or remedy.

 

(b)            No Waiver. No delay or failure by Mortgagee to accelerate the Loan or exercise any right, power, or remedy shall be deemed a waiver by Mortgagee of, or estop Mortgagee from, the future exercise thereof. No partial exercise of any right, power, or remedy shall preclude the further exercise thereof. Notice or demand given to Mortgagor in any instance shall not entitle Mortgagor to notice or demand in any other instance, except as expressly required by the Loan Documents or by Applicable Law. Mortgagee may release security for the Loan, may release any party liable therefor, may grant extensions and forbearances, may accept partial or past due amounts, and may apply any sums or other security held by Mortgagee to the repayment of the Loan, in each case without prejudice to Mortgagee and without such action being deemed an accord and satisfaction or a reinstatement of the Loan.

 

41


 

 

 

(c)            Discontinuance of Proceedings. If Mortgagee commences the enforcement of any right, power, or remedy, whether afforded under the Loan Documents or otherwise and such enforcement is then discontinued or abandoned for any reason, then and in every such case, Mortgagee shall be restored to its former positions and rights hereunder without waiver of any Event of Default and without novation, and all rights, powers, and remedies of Mortgagee shall continue as if no such enforcement had been commenced.

 

(d)            Reimbursement for Enforcement Costs. Mortgagor shall reimburse Mortgagee within thirty (30) days of written demand for all reasonable actual and documented costs, fees, and expenses (including loan servicing fees and reasonable attorneys’ fees) incurred by Mortgagee in connection with any enforcement action taken in accordance with this Article IX. All sums so incurred shall be added to the Debt and shall be secured by this Mortgage. The exercise by Mortgagor of any statutory rights of redemption shall be expressly conditioned on Mortgagor’s payment of the foregoing and on the payment and performance of all obligations required under any applicable redemption statute.

 

(e)            Right of Setoff. In addition to, but not in limitation of, any rights, remedies, and powers granted to Mortgagee and the other Secured Creditors under the Loan Documents, at law, or in equity, each Secured Creditor is hereby authorized at any time and from time to time, without notice to Mortgagor or any other Person, such notice being hereby expressly waived, to apply to the Obligations owed such Secured Creditor under the Loan Documents any amounts then deposited in any escrow or reserve account, if any, or in such Secured Creditor’s possession, or over which such Secured Creditor has a security interest, including any Restoration Proceeds. Such right shall be exercisable by such Secured Creditor only after the Obligations for which such amounts are secured have matured or been accelerated in accordance with this Mortgage, subject, with respect to any Secured Creditor other than Mortgagee, to Section 5.06 of the Notes.

 

(f)            Application of Proceeds. The proceeds of the Property, together with any other sums that may be held by Mortgagee under this Mortgage, whether under the provisions of this Article IX or otherwise, shall be applied in the order Mortgagee determines in its discretion or as directed by Required Holders, as the case may be, except as otherwise expressly required by the Loan Documents, an order from a New York court of competent jurisdiction, or the requirements of Applicable Law.

Section 10.10 New York Statutory Provisions. In the event of any inconsistencies between the terms and conditions of this Section 10.10 and the other terms and conditions of the Mortgage, the terms and conditions of this Section 10.10 shall control and be binding, but only to the extent of such inconsistency.

 

(a)            Statement Pursuant to New York Tax Law; Commercial Property. Mortgagor represents and warrants that within the meaning prescribed under N.Y. Tax Law Section 2531(1-a)(a), this Mortgage does not encumber real property principally improved or to be improved by one (1) or more structures containing in the aggregate not more than six (6) residential dwelling units, each having their own separate cooking facilities.

 

(b)            Maximum Principal Indebtedness Secured. Notwithstanding anything contained herein to the contrary, the maximum principal indebtedness secured by this Mortgage at execution or which under any contingency may become secured hereby at any time hereafter is the principal sum of FORTY-ONE MILLION AND NO/100 DOLLARS ($41,000,000.00) plus all accrued but unpaid interest thereon and all amounts expended by Mortgagee hereunder to maintain the lien of this Mortgage or to protect the Property secured by this Mortgage during the continuance of an Event of Default, to the extent that any such amounts shall constitute payment of (a) taxes, charges or assessments which may be imposed by law upon the Property; (b) premiums on insurance policies covering the Property; and (c) reasonable and documented expenses reasonably incurred in upholding the lien of this Mortgage, including (i) the expenses of any litigation to prosecute or defend the rights and lien created by this Mortgage, (ii) any amount, cost or charges to which Mortgagee becomes subrogated, upon payment, whether under recognized principles of law or equity, or under express statutory authority and (iii) interest at the Default Rate in accordance with the terms herein.

 

45


 

 

 

(c)            Statement Pursuant to New York Real Property Law Article 4-a. If this Mortgage shall be deemed to constitute a “mortgage investment” as defined by New York Real Property Law Section 125, then this Mortgage shall and hereby confers upon Mortgagee the powers and imposes upon Mortgagee the duties of trustees set forth in New York Real Property Law Section 126.

 

(d)            Section 13 of New York Lien Law. Pursuant to Section 13 of the Lien Law of New York, Mortgagor shall receive the advances secured hereby and shall hold the right to receive such advances as a trust fund to be applied first for the purpose of paying the cost of any improvement and shall apply such advances first to the payment of the cost of any improvement before using any part thereof for any other purpose. Mortgagor shall comply strictly with Section 13 of the Lien Law of New York.

 

(e)            Section 291-f Protection. Mortgagee shall have all the rights set forth in Section 291-f of the Real Property Law of New York. For purposes thereto, all existing tenants and every tenant or subtenant who, after the recording of this Mortgage, enters into a Lease of any portion of the Property, or who acquires by instrument of assignment or by operation of law a leasehold estate upon the Property, is hereby notified that Mortgagor may not, without obtaining Mortgagee’s prior written consent in each instance, cancel, abridge, or modify any Lease, or accept any prepayments of rent for more than one (1) month in advance of its due date with respect to any Lease thereof having an unexpired term on the date of this Mortgage of five (5) years or more, except as expressly permitted under the Loan Documents, and that any such cancellation, modification, or prepayment made by any such tenant or subtenant without either being expressly permitted under this Mortgage or receiving Mortgagee’s prior written consent shall be voidable by Mortgagee at its option.

 

(f)            Statutory Rights Not Exclusive. Except as otherwise expressly provided herein, all covenants of Mortgagor herein contained shall be construed as affording to Mortgagee rights additional to and not exclusive of the rights conferred under the provisions of Sections 254, 271, 272, and 291-f of the New York Real Property Law.

 

(g)            Section 254(4) of the RPL. In the event of any conflict, inconsistency, or ambiguity between the provisions of this Mortgage and the provisions of subsection 4 of Section 254 of the Real Property Law of New York covering the insurance of buildings against loss by fire, the provisions of this Mortgage shall control.

 

(h)            Release and Assignment. Notwithstanding anything to the contrary contained in this Mortgage, upon payment to Mortgagee of the indebtedness secured by this Mortgage, Mortgagor shall be entitled to receive, at the option and upon the written request of Mortgagor, either a release of record of this Mortgage or an assignment of this Mortgage by Mortgagee to any new lender designated by Mortgagor in recordable form, without payment of any further sums to Mortgagee other than Mortgagee’s customary and reasonable servicing fees and reasonable attorneys’ fees relating thereto.
